Job Description

The Finance Internship at ATHLETES FIRST will provide you with a great deal of hands-on experience and insight into the world of sports through the agency lens. It is a great opportunity for a passionate, creative, and focused graduate or exceptional undergraduate student who is interested in a career in sports or entertainment management. Over the course of the internship, the candidate would work closely with an our finance department, assisting in a variety of both challenging and interesting projects surrounding our professional and collegiate athletics.

*The Summer Internship will begin May 5th to August 29th

General Finance & Accounting Projects
  • Prepare standard reports for finance and business teams
  • Manage weekly process of expense categorization
  • Assist with data and financials for presentations
  • General office duties and administrative services as assigned
  • Reconcile and improve transaction data related to expenses
  • Improve base data related to clients and billing
Operations & Process
  • Documentation and create presentations related to operational policies and process
  • Work-flow and process improvement analysis
  • Ad hoc projects in Accounting and Finance as needed
Requirements:
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ail
  • Extremely organized and able to handle multiple tasks simultaneously
  • Polished written and oral communication skills
  • Strong ability to work as part of a team, as some coworkers will be in satellite offices
  • Critical thinker and problem solver
  • Strong knowledge of the Microsoft Office su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ook)

*This is a for-credit internship. You must be able to receive college credit to be eligible for the internship*

*remote options may be considered*
